- The distance between Billings/ Logan, Mt, Usa and Palmeira Dos Indios, Brazil is approximately 9,391 km or 5,835 mi.
- To reach Billings/ Logan, Mt in this distance one would set out from Palmeira Dos Indios bearing 318.3° or NW and follow the great circles arc to approach Billings/ Logan, Mt bearing 289.7° or WNW .
- Billings/ Logan, Mt has a hot summer continental climate with no dry season (Dfa) whereas Palmeira Dos Indios has a tropical wet and dry/ savanna climate with dry summers (As).
- Billings/ Logan, Mt is in or near the cool temperate steppe biome whereas Palmeira Dos Indios is in or near the subtropical moist forest biome.
- The average temperature is 16 °C (28.8°F) cooler.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 22.8 °C (41°F) more in Billings/ Logan, Mt. The continentality subtype is subcontinental as opposed to truly hyperoceanic.
- Total annual precipitation averages 486.4 mm (19.1 in) less which is equivalent to 486.4 l/m² (11.94 US gal/ft²) or 4,864,000 l/ha (519,994 US gal/ac) less. About 4/9 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 28.8° lower in Billings/ Logan, Mt than in Palmeira Dos Indios.
